src_stat 360 src/filemanager/file.c check_hardlinks (file_op_context_t *ctx, const vfs_path_t *src_vpath, const struct stat *src_stat, src_stat 364 src/filemanager/file.c ino_t ino = src_stat->st_ino; src_stat 365 src/filemanager/file.c dev_t dev = src_stat->st_dev; src_stat 367 src/filemanager/file.c if (src_stat->st_nlink < 2) src_stat 372 src/filemanager/file.c lnk = (link_t *) is_in_linklist (linklist, src_vpath, src_stat); src_stat 1068 src/filemanager/file.c query_replace (file_op_context_t *ctx, const char *src, struct stat *src_stat, const char *dst, src_stat 1081 src/filemanager/file.c return parent_call (pntr.p, ctx, 4, strlen (src), src, sizeof (struct stat), src_stat, src_stat 1084 src/filemanager/file.c return file_progress_real_query_replace (ctx, Foreground, src, src_stat, dst, dst_stat); src_stat 1107 src/filemanager/file.c query_replace (file_op_context_t *ctx, const char *src, struct stat *src_stat, const char *dst, src_stat 1110 src/filemanager/file.c return file_progress_real_query_replace (ctx, Foreground, src, src_stat, dst, dst_stat); src_stat 1210 src/filemanager/file.c struct stat src_stat, dst_stat; src_stat 1231 src/filemanager/file.c while (mc_lstat (src_vpath, &src_stat) != 0) src_stat 1249 src/filemanager/file.c if (check_same_file (ctx, s, &src_stat, d, &dst_stat, &return_status)) src_stat 1262 src/filemanager/file.c return_status = query_replace (ctx, s, &src_stat, d, &dst_stat); src_stat 1271 src/filemanager/file.c if (S_ISLNK (src_stat.st_mode) && ctx->stable_symlinks) src_stat 1280 src/filemanager/file.c vfs_get_timesbuf_from_stat (&src_stat, ×); src_stat 1321 src/filemanager/file.c return_status = panel_operate_init_totals (panel, src_vpath, &src_stat, ctx, TRUE, src_stat 1360 src/filemanager/file.c progress_update_one (TRUE, ctx, src_stat.st_size); src_stat 1613 src/filemanager/file.c struct stat src_stat, dst_stat; src_stat 1634 src/filemanager/file.c mc_stat (src_vpath, &src_stat); src_stat 1638 src/filemanager/file.c if (dstat_ok && check_same_file (ctx, s, &src_stat, d, &dst_stat, &return_status)) src_stat 1666 src/filemanager/file.c return_status = panel_operate_init_totals (panel, src_vpath, &src_stat, ctx, TRUE, src_stat 1722 src/filemanager/file.c return_status = panel_operate_init_totals (panel, src_vpath, &src_stat, ctx, TRUE, src_stat 1801 src/filemanager/file.c check_single_entry (const WPanel *panel, gboolean force_single, struct stat *src_stat) src_stat 1830 src/filemanager/file.c ok = mc_lstat (source_vpath, src_stat) == 0; src_stat 1863 src/filemanager/file.c const struct stat *src_stat) src_stat 1908 src/filemanager/file.c cp = (src_stat != NULL ? one_format : many_format); src_stat 1920 src/filemanager/file.c if (src_stat != NULL) src_stat 1921 src/filemanager/file.c cp = S_ISDIR (src_stat->st_mode) ? prompt_parts[2] : prompt_parts[0]; src_stat 1944 src/filemanager/file.c struct stat *src_stat, file_op_context_t *ctx, gboolean *do_bg) src_stat 1980 src/filemanager/file.c src_stat = NULL; src_stat 1983 src/filemanager/file.c format = panel_operate_generate_prompt (panel, ctx->operation, src_stat); src_stat 1998 src/filemanager/file.c do_confirm_erase (const WPanel *panel, const char *source, struct stat *src_stat) src_stat 2005 src/filemanager/file.c src_stat = NULL; src_stat 2008 src/filemanager/file.c format = panel_operate_generate_prompt (panel, OP_DELETE, src_stat); src_stat 2034 src/filemanager/file.c struct stat *src_stat, const char *dest, filegui_dialog_type_t dialog_type) src_stat 2045 src/filemanager/file.c is_file = !S_ISDIR (src_stat->st_mode); src_stat 2051 src/filemanager/file.c is_link = file_is_symlink_to_dir (src_vpath, src_stat, NULL); src_stat 2057 src/filemanager/file.c value = panel_operate_init_totals (panel, src_vpath, src_stat, ctx, !is_file, dialog_type); src_stat 2081 src/filemanager/file.c ctx->stat_func (src_vpath, src_stat); src_stat 2083 src/filemanager/file.c value = panel_operate_init_totals (panel, src_vpath, src_stat, ctx, !is_file, src_stat 2087 src/filemanager/file.c is_file = !S_ISDIR (src_stat->st_mode); src_stat 2093 src/filemanager/file.c is_link = file_is_symlink_to_dir (src_vpath, src_stat, NULL); src_stat 2135 src/filemanager/file.c struct stat *src_stat, const char *dest) src_stat 2146 src/filemanager/file.c is_file = !S_ISDIR (src_stat->st_mode); src_stat 2170 src/filemanager/file.c ctx->stat_func (src_vpath, src_stat); src_stat 2171 src/filemanager/file.c is_file = !S_ISDIR (src_stat->st_mode); src_stat 2286 src/filemanager/file.c struct stat src_stat, dst_stat; src_stat 2342 src/filemanager/file.c while ((*ctx->stat_func) (src_vpath, &src_stat) != 0) src_stat 2363 src/filemanager/file.c src_mode = src_stat.st_mode; src_stat 2364 src/filemanager/file.c src_uid = src_stat.st_uid; src_stat 2365 src/filemanager/file.c src_gid = src_stat.st_gid; src_stat 2366 src/filemanager/file.c file_size = src_stat.st_size; src_stat 2397 src/filemanager/file.c if (check_same_file (ctx, src_path, &src_stat, dst_path, &dst_stat, &return_status)) src_stat 2404 src/filemanager/file.c return_status = query_replace (ctx, src_path, &src_stat, dst_path, &dst_stat); src_stat 2410 src/filemanager/file.c vfs_get_timesbuf_from_stat (&src_stat, ×); src_stat 2417 src/filemanager/file.c switch (check_hardlinks (ctx, src_vpath, &src_stat, dst_vpath, &ctx->ignore_all)) src_stat 2433 src/filemanager/file.c if (S_ISLNK (src_stat.st_mode)) src_stat 2464 src/filemanager/file.c if (S_ISCHR (src_stat.st_mode) || S_ISBLK (src_stat.st_mode) || S_ISFIFO (src_stat.st_mode) src_stat 2465 src/filemanager/file.c || S_ISNAM (src_stat.st_mode) || S_ISSOCK (src_stat.st_mode)) src_stat 2470 src/filemanager/file.c rdev = src_stat.st_rdev; src_stat 2473 src/filemanager/file.c while (mc_mknod (dst_vpath, src_stat.st_mode & ctx->umask_kill, rdev) < 0 src_stat 2487 src/filemanager/file.c && mc_chown (dst_vpath, src_stat.st_uid, src_stat.st_gid) != 0 src_stat 2503 src/filemanager/file.c while (ctx->preserve && mc_chmod (dst_vpath, src_stat.st_mode & ctx->umask_kill) != 0 src_stat 2576 src/filemanager/file.c while (mc_fstat (src_desc, &src_stat) != 0) src_stat 2594 src/filemanager/file.c src_mode = src_stat.st_mode; src_stat 2595 src/filemanager/file.c src_uid = src_stat.st_uid; src_stat 2596 src/filemanager/file.c src_gid = src_stat.st_gid; src_stat 2597 src/filemanager/file.c file_size = src_stat.st_size; src_stat 3012 src/filemanager/file.c struct stat dst_stat, src_stat; src_stat 3027 src/filemanager/file.c while ((*ctx->stat_func) (src_vpath, &src_stat) != 0) src_stat 3069 src/filemanager/file.c if (is_in_linklist (dest_dirs, src_vpath, &src_stat) != NULL) src_stat 3083 src/filemanager/file.c switch (check_hardlinks (ctx, src_vpath, &src_stat, dst_vpath, &ctx->ignore_all)) src_stat 3098 src/filemanager/file.c if (!S_ISDIR (src_stat.st_mode)) src_stat 3113 src/filemanager/file.c if (is_in_linklist (parent_dirs, src_vpath, &src_stat) != NULL) src_stat 3123 src/filemanager/file.c lp->ino = src_stat.st_ino; src_stat 3124 src/filemanager/file.c lp->dev = src_stat.st_dev; src_stat 3180 src/filemanager/file.c while (my_mkdir (dst_vpath, (src_stat.st_mode & ctx->umask_kill) | S_IRWXU) != 0) src_stat 3205 src/filemanager/file.c while (mc_chown (dst_vpath, src_stat.st_uid, src_stat.st_gid) != 0) src_stat 3293 src/filemanager/file.c mc_chmod (dst_vpath, src_stat.st_mode & ctx->umask_kill); src_stat 3298 src/filemanager/file.c vfs_get_timesbuf_from_stat (&src_stat, ×); src_stat 3303 src/filemanager/file.c src_stat.st_mode = umask (-1); src_stat 3304 src/filemanager/file.c umask (src_stat.st_mode); src_stat 3305 src/filemanager/file.c src_stat.st_mode = 0100777 & ~src_stat.st_mode; src_stat 3306 src/filemanager/file.c mc_chmod (dst_vpath, src_stat.st_mode & ctx->umask_kill); src_stat 3509 src/filemanager/file.c struct stat src_stat; src_stat 3533 src/filemanager/file.c source = check_single_entry (panel, force_single, &src_stat); src_stat 3544 src/filemanager/file.c dest = do_confirm_copy_move (panel, force_single, source, &src_stat, ctx, &do_bg); src_stat 3553 src/filemanager/file.c else if (confirm_delete && !do_confirm_erase (panel, source, &src_stat)) src_stat 3636 src/filemanager/file.c value = operate_single_file (panel, ctx, source, &src_stat, dest, dialog_type); src_stat 3678 src/filemanager/file.c src_stat = panel->dir.list[i].st; src_stat 3680 src/filemanager/file.c value = operate_one_file (panel, ctx, source2, &src_stat, dest); src_stat 234 src/filemanager/filegui.c struct stat *src_stat, *dst_stat; src_stat 557 src/filemanager/filegui.c size_trunc_len (s2, sizeof (s2), ui->src_stat->st_size, 0, panels_options.kilobyte_si); src_stat 560 src/filemanager/filegui.c cs1 = file_date (ui->src_stat->st_mtime); src_stat 581 src/filemanager/filegui.c do_append && ui->dst_stat->st_size != 0 && ui->src_stat->st_size > ui->dst_stat->st_size; src_stat 1270 src/filemanager/filegui.c struct stat *src_stat, const char *dst, struct stat *dst_stat) src_stat 1284 src/filemanager/filegui.c ui->src_stat = src_stat; src_stat 1291 src/filemanager/filegui.c (src_stat->st_size == 0 && ui->dont_overwrite_with_zero) ? FILE_SKIP : FILE_CONT; src_stat 1297 src/filemanager/filegui.c if (src_stat->st_mtime > dst_stat->st_mtime) src_stat 1304 src/filemanager/filegui.c if (src_stat->st_size == dst_stat->st_size) src_stat 1311 src/filemanager/filegui.c if (src_stat->st_size > dst_stat->st_size) src_stat 188 src/filemanager/filegui.h struct stat *src_stat, const char *dst,